Q: Is 8,748,224 a Prime Number?

 A: No, 8,748,224 is not a prime number.

Why is 8,748,224 not a prime number?

A prime number is a natural number, greater than one, that can only be divided by 1 and itself.

The number 8748224 can be evenly divided by 1 2 4 8 16 32 64 136,691 273,382 546,764 1,093,528 2,187,056 4,374,112 and 8,748,224, with no remainder.

Since 8,748,224 cannot be divided by just 1 and 8,748,224, it is not a prime number.
